District Collector Ranjeet Singh chaired a meeting here on Tuesday with the senior officials of all government departments to review the preparations being made ahead of the northeast monsoon which is likely to be heavy due to El-Nino.Addressing the meeting, Mr. Ranjeet Singh said the Public Works Department, with the help of tahsildar concerned, should impartially remove all encroachments made along the watercourses, channels, and on the waterbodies. The people living close to the low-lying areas should be alerted ahead of start of the monsoon and given information about the nearest relief camps.The places identified for creating relief camps such as schools, community halls, and private marriage halls in elevated areas should be inspected by the officials, who should ensure the availability of food, electricity, drinking water, medical assistance and so on in these places.The Forest Department should keep ready sufficient number of casuarina poles and identify experts in rescuing snakes that could slither into residential areas during rain.Fire and Rescue Services personnel should keep ready life jackets in adequate number, inflatable boats, swimmers, and other rescue equipment. The local bodies – right from the village panchayats to the municipalities – should dredge all drains in their jurisdiction before the start of the northeast monsoon. The local bodies should ensure the sufficient protected drinking water supply to residents after due chlorination.Localised real-time weather forecast should be shared with the residents instantly, the Collector said.Mr. Ranjeet Singh instructed the officials of Public Health Department to stock up medicines in sufficient quantity in all hospitals – right from the primary health centres to the government hospitals where generators should be kept functional with sufficient fuel stock. Oxygen cylinders and life-saving fluids should be stocked, he said. Published - September 08, 2026 09:00 pm IST
